For the first time, AUK students graduated from Arizona State University and participated in a ceremony with more than 5,000 graduates from all over the world.
AUK was presented at the ceremony alongside with other universities of Cintana Education, global network of 18 forward-looking institutions working together to bring the best technologies and practices to their students.

While addressing AUK graduates in ASU, Çağrı Bağcıoğlu, Regional CEO for Eastern Europe and Central Asia of Cintana Education, outlined:
"When we started this journey to establish AUK, we knew its significance as a university. However, with the start of this devastating war, it is now more than a university. AUK will continue to educate the future leaders of Ukraine who will rebuild this wonderful country".
